Overly Creative Layout That Confuses ATSHIGH
Why it hurts
  • ATS can't parse graphics
  • Hiring managers may miss key info
  • File size may be too large
How to fix
  • Use a clean, ATS‑friendly template
  • Keep fonts standard and sizes readable
  • Limit decorative elements to a header or portfolio link
❌ Before

A resume with a full‑bleed background, custom fonts, and embedded images of sketches.

✓ After

A minimalist PDF with clear headings, standard fonts, and a clickable portfolio URL.

ATS Tip
Stick to simple bullet points and avoid tables.
Detection Rules
Contains images or graphics
Uses non‑standard fonts
Has background colors

Missing Quantifiable AchievementsMEDIUM
Why it hurts
  • Hiring managers can’t gauge impact
  • Resume looks vague
  • Hard to differentiate from others
How to fix
  • Add numbers: % increase in sales, number of collections launched
  • Use specific project names
  • Show measurable results of design work
❌ Before

Designed seasonal collections for a major retailer.

✓ After

Designed 3 seasonal collections for XYZ Retail, boosting sales by 18% YoY.

ATS Tip
Include keywords like 'increased', 'launched', 'revenue' with numbers.
Detection Rules
Lacks digits
No percentages or dollar amounts

No Portfolio Link or Poorly Presented PortfolioHIGH
Why it hurts
  • Creative roles rely on visual proof
  • Hiring managers must click to see work
  • Broken links look unprofessional
How to fix
  • Add a short, clean URL to an online portfolio
  • Ensure link is clickable in PDF
  • Provide a brief description of portfolio content
❌ Before

Portfolio: mysite.com/portfolio (not hyperlinked)

✓ After

Portfolio: https://behance.net/janedoe (clickable) – Showcases 20+ runway looks and editorial shoots.

ATS Tip
Place the URL in the contact section, not in the summary.
Detection Rules
Contains 'portfolio' without http
URL not hyperlinked

Incorrect Date or Location FormattingMEDIUM
Why it hurts
  • ATS may misinterpret dates
  • Hiring managers can’t see timeline
  • Inconsistent locations look sloppy
How to fix
  • Use MM/YYYY format
  • Place city, state after each role
  • Keep dates aligned to the right
❌ Before

June 2019 – Present

✓ After

06/2019 – Present

ATS Tip
Standardize dates to MM/YYYY for ATS parsing.
Detection Rules
Dates written as words
Inconsistent date separators

Formatting Guidelines
File Types: PDF (preferred), DOCX
Sections: Header, Professional Summary, Key Skills, Experience, Education, Portfolio Link, Awards & Certifications
Naming: FirstName_LastName_FashionDesigner_Resume
Consistency
Length: One page for early‑career, up to two pages for senior designers
Date Format: MM/YYYY
Location Format: City, State (or Country)
Resume Quality Checklist
  • Use a clean, ATS‑friendly template
  • Include a clickable portfolio URL
  • Quantify achievements with numbers
  • Tailor keywords to fashion design roles
  • Keep dates in MM/YYYY format
  • Proofread for spelling and grammar
  • Save as PDF with searchable text
ATS Alignment Guide
Common ATS Systems: Greenhouse, iCIMS, Workday, Lever
Keyword Strategy: Use terms like 'collection development', 'trend forecasting', 'CAD', 'Adobe Illustrator', 'fabric sourcing'
Heading Format: Standard headings such as 'Professional Summary', 'Experience', 'Education', 'Skills' are best recognized.
